I'll bet you thought the presidential campaign couldn't get any dirtier. Wrong!

Kitty Kelley is publishing a new book called "The Family: The Real Story of the Bush Dynasty."

She will appear for three straight mornings on The Today Show next week.

The book appears to be full of unnamed sources testifying to illegal drug use by President Bush more than 30 years ago.

One of the sources is said to be Sharon Bush, ex-wife of Neil Bush, one of the president's brothers.

Kelley has had a checkered career in dealing dirt about Nancy Reagan, the British Royal family and Frank Sinatra.

She gets a lot of attention because her claims and charges are often outrageous.

Coming in the midst of an election season and with the liberal media looking for ways to blunt the president's improving ratings, the Kelley book is perfect timing for liberal democrats.

There's more coming. Former Texas Lt. Governor Ben Barnes claims he helped get the president a National Guard slot by pulling strings.

Barnes had his own scandal in Houston 30-plus years ago.

And so it goes. Voters would do well to consider the source of these things.
